HC Deb 13 April 1965 vol 710 c187W
Mr. Dunnett

asked the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food whether, in view of the potentially dangerous character of some traditionally non-domesticated animals, he will impose restrictions on their importation into the United Kingdom where it is intended to employ them as domestic pets.

Sir F. Soskice

I have been asked to reply. I have seen reports of a recent tragic incident. This fortunately appears to have been an isolated one and I am not at present convinced that legislation, which to be effective would have to control possession as well as importation of wild animals, is desirable.
